Design Matters: To drive results, consider the effectiveness of design.

Design Matters

While there is understandably much focus on Search Engine Optimization, when a web viewer is delivered from a link they’ve found on organic, paid or linked search to their desired destination — even if the content is high quality — and the resulting web site’s visual presentation is average, cluttered or unprofessionally executed and the viewer has to work too hard to find the information they are searching for, the page view has a high likely hood of being quickly abandoned.

New Ad-ology Study: Reduced Advertising During Recession Negatively Impacts Consumer Perception

The need to continue promoting your company or organization's message through marketing and advertising is even more crutial during a recession. Since perception is reality, a minimal or limited-message strategy will be perceived as a sign of business weakness.

The conversation will continue whether your company joins and shapes the message or lets the marketplace do it for them.
